About
An acrylate monomer used to make cosmetic film-forming polymers. As a free monomer it is flammable, irritating, and a skin sensitizer — only acceptable in cosmetics as trace residue inside cured polymer.

Known concerns
- Free monomer — flammable, skin and eye irritant (H315/H319)
- Skin sensitizer (H317)
- Respiratory irritant (H335) and STOT hazards in some classifications
- Should be present only as trace residue in polymers
